- Notes:
- Concerning the appointment of John Cleves Symmes Harrison, son of General William Henry Harrison, as receiver at the Vincennes land office, and criticizing the general as an elected official who put private interests above public duty.
- Signed: Truth illustrated. Monday, October 11, 1819.
- Presumably printed at Cincinnati, Hamilton Co., Ohio.
